- 博客(0)
- 资源 (2)
空空如也
设计模式之命令模式程序代码
命令模式
一个服务可以输出四种符号“A,B,C,D”,现在有多个用户要调用这个服务输出不同的字符,每调用一次输出一个字符,请用命令模式实现一个队列缓冲,用户直接向缓冲中填写命令,服务程序负责循环从队列中取出命令并执行输出
2009-06-12
设计模式之责任链模式程序
一、责任链模式
现有 “战士”、“班长”、“排长”、“连长”,“营长”五种角色,当有人要请假时要进行以下处理
1.只能是下级象上级请假(如“排长”只能向“连长请假”)
2.班长可以批准1天内的假期,排长批5天,连长批10天,营长批20天,20以上不准假
请用责任链模式处理以下情况,输出具体的批准过程:
1.战士请12天假
2.排长请3天假
2009-06-12
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人